Rates & Terms
Borrowers in Malden with credit scores above 760 and 20% down payments qualify for the best conventional mortgage rates.
VA loans available to veterans in Malden often feature the lowest rates and require no down payment or private mortgage insurance.
Requirements in Malden
Jumbo loans in Malden for amounts exceeding conforming limits require credit scores of 700+, larger down payments, and significant cash reserves.
FHA loans in MA accept credit scores as low as 580 with 3.5% down, or 500-579 with 10% down.

Borrowing Tips for Malden
- Consider a 15-year mortgage if you can afford the higher payment; you will save massive interest over the loan life.
- Save for closing costs in addition to your down payment; expect 2-5% of the loan amount for closing expenses.
- Improve your credit score by 20+ points before applying; even small improvements can lower your rate significantly.
